Pool Table Sizes

What is the standard pool table size?
  • The typical pool table sizes ranges from 6ft - 9ft in length. The 8ft and 9ft - are recognised for tournament play by the governing bodies, while the 7ft is the most popular size for homes and dining pool tables.

How much space do I need for a pool table?
  • While we have a detailed room size guide, the quick answer is to simply add 5ft to the perimeter dimensions of your desired table (assuming you're using a standard 57" cue). As an example, a 8ft x 4ft table will require a 18ft x 14ft space.
Are Playing and Dining heights the same for Dining Pool Tables?
  • Most 2-in-1 pool tables have a playing height that's slightly adjusted downwards for dining but still well within play limits.
  • Some pool tables come with legs with height adjusters for easy adjustment to your desired height, as well as mechanisms that switch between 2 heights for dine or play.  
  • Another workaround is to opt for accompanying benches or higher chairs.

Pool Tables Types

What's the Difference between American and British Pool Tables?

  • American pool tables are typically larger, with a 9ft length compared to 7ft for British pool tables. American pool ball sizes are bigger at 2"1/4 (vs 2").
  • While both games feature 16 balls including cue and black balls, American Pool balls are coloured stripes and solids versus British pool's Yellow and Red balls.
  • American pool tables have rounded corners, use worsted 'speed' cloth compared to the square-shaped pockets for British pool.
